- [ ] Confirm the Brindlequeue broker upgrade completed on all ceremony hosts; verify TLS listeners restarted cleanly and no queue replayed unsigned messages. Check the upgrade attestation log against the reviewer copy. When satisfied, unseal the signing partition using the recovery passphrase, which follows on the next line.

vault phrase of bagaf-kajeg = jorath-feniel-briir-siliel-ralix

Finance Review — Board Summary

Closure of the Dunmere satellite office is recommended. Annual savings of roughly 410k against one-time exit costs of 120k, breakeven inside five months. Nine staff relocate to Harwick; two roles are eliminated. Lease termination is agreed in principle. The confidential business rationale is set out below.

board note of kafog-bajep: Briathek Partners is in early talks to buy Aldaelek Group for about $47.1 million. The Ulaath launch date is September 4, and nothing goes to the press before then.

## Further reading

The Bramblegate partner SFTP drop is where Tillhaven Foods uploads their nightly inventory files. Our poller sweeps it every twenty minutes and feeds the parser — most weirdness traces back to their filename conventions, not our code. If a file goes missing, check the quarantine folder first. Full details, including retention rules and retry behavior, live on the wiki here.

dashboard of yafog-fajof = https://jira.tolvaqsys.internal/pages/pages/projects/49fe21c4